#a91622 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a91622 is composed of 66.3% red, 8.6%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87% magenta, 79.9% yellow and 33.7% black. It has a hue angle of 355.1 degrees, a saturation of 77% and a lightness of 37.5%. #a91622 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2c44 with #530000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

#a91622 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a91622 has RGB values of R:169, G:22, B:34 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.87, Y:0.8, K:0.34. Its decimal value is 11081250.

Shades and Tints of #a91622
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0203 is the darkest color, while #fefafb is the lightest one.

Tones of #a91622
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#605f5f is the less saturated color, while #b80716 is the most saturated one.
